Headword:
*(ippodasei/hs
Adler number: iota,557
Translated headword: horsehair-bushy
Vetting Status: high
Translation: [Meaning] having a crest [made] from the hairs of horses, i.e. a bushy one.
Greek Original:*(ippodasei/hs: e)c i(ppei/wn trixw=n lo/fon e)xou/shs, o(\ dh\ dasu/ e)stin.
Note:
Likewise or similarly in other lexica. The headword is feminine genitive singular of this adjective. It occurs five times in
Homer,
Iliad, describing a helmet. See e.g. 6.9, with scholion. (For the glossing cf. also the
scholia to 17.295; nominative there.)
